本文目录导读:
分时操作系统(Time-sharing Operating System)是一种使多个用户同时使用计算机资源的操作系统,它将计算机的处理时间、存储空间和外部设备合理分配给多个用户,实现用户之间的快速切换,提高了计算机的使用效率,本文将从分时操作系统的特点、工作原理和应用领域等方面进行详细阐述。
分时操作系统的特点
1、多用户共享:分时操作系统允许多个用户同时使用计算机资源,提高计算机的利用率,用户可以通过终端、网络等方式接入系统,实现资源共享。
2、快速响应:分时操作系统采用时间片轮转调度算法,使每个用户都能在短时间内获得系统响应,这提高了用户的工作效率,降低了用户等待时间。
图片来源于网络,如有侵权联系删除
3、交互式操作:分时操作系统支持用户与计算机之间的交互式操作,用户可以通过命令行或图形界面进行操作,实现人机交互。
4、作业隔离:分时操作系统为每个用户分配独立的作业空间,确保用户之间的作业不会相互干扰,这提高了系统的稳定性和安全性。
5、实时性:分时操作系统具有较高的实时性,能够满足用户对系统响应速度的要求,特别是在处理实时性要求较高的任务时,如工业控制、通信等,分时操作系统具有明显优势。
6、资源优化:分时操作系统采用多种调度策略,合理分配计算机资源,提高资源利用率,这有助于降低系统成本,提高经济效益。
分时操作系统的工作原理
1、时间片轮转调度:分时操作系统采用时间片轮转调度算法,将CPU时间分配给多个用户,每个用户获得一定的时间片后,系统自动切换到下一个用户,实现快速响应。
图片来源于网络,如有侵权联系删除
2、作业管理:分时操作系统将用户提交的作业分为多个进程,为每个进程分配资源,系统根据进程优先级和调度策略,实现作业的合理调度。
3、存储管理:分时操作系统采用虚拟存储技术,将用户作业存储在虚拟存储器中,系统根据进程需要,动态分配物理内存,实现存储空间的合理利用。
4、输入/输出管理:分时操作系统采用缓冲区技术,提高输入/输出设备的效率,系统通过合理分配缓冲区,减少设备等待时间,提高系统整体性能。
分时操作系统的应用领域
1、计算机辅助设计(CAD):分时操作系统在CAD领域具有广泛的应用,能够满足用户对实时性和交互性的需求。
2、数据库管理系统(DBMS):分时操作系统在DBMS中具有重要作用,能够提高数据库的并发访问能力,提高系统性能。
图片来源于网络,如有侵权联系删除
3、电信网络:分时操作系统在电信网络中用于处理大量实时性要求较高的任务,如电话交换、数据传输等。
4、云计算:分时操作系统在云计算领域具有重要作用,能够实现资源的合理分配和调度,提高云计算平台的性能。
分时操作系统以其高效、便捷、共享的特点,在各个领域得到了广泛应用,随着计算机技术的不断发展,分时操作系统将发挥越来越重要的作用。
标签: #分时操作系统特点
评论列表